How to calculate 2700 divided by 45 using long division?
Division is a fundamental arithmetic operation where we calculate how many times a number (divisor or denominator) can fit into another number (dividend or numerator). In this case, we are dividing 2,700 (the dividend) by 45 (the divisor).
There are three distinct methods to convey the same information: in decimal, fractional, and percentage formats:
- 2,700 divided by 45 in decimal = 60
- 2,700 divided by 45 in fraction = 2,700/45
- 2,700 divided by 45 in percentage = 6,000%
What is the Quotient and Remainder of 2,700 divided by 45?
The quotient is calculated by dividing the dividend by the divisor, and the remainder is what's left over if the division doesn't result in a whole number. In this case, however, since 2,700 is a multiple of 45, there should be no remainder.
The quotient of 2,700 divided by 45 is 60, and the remainder is 0. Thus,
2,700 ÷ 45 = 60 R 0
When you divide Two Thousand Seven Hundred by Forty Five, the quotient is Sixty, and the remainder is Zero.
